Should you be the one writing your firm’s blogs — or is your time better spent elsewhere? In this episode, Marc Cerniglia breaks down why even the best writer-lawyers are usually not the best marketers. He also explores how professional writers — and even AI tools like ChatGPT — can help your firm produce content that’s not just accurate, but engaging and readable for real clients.

📌 Key Takeaways:

  • Writing your own blogs isn’t the best use of your time as a lawyer.
  • Professional writers understand how to connect with your audience.
  • AI can assist, but strategy still matters more than who’s typing.
